MOVA Unveils Innovative Robotic Lawn Mowers and Pool Cleaner at CES 2026

MOVA, a leading name in smart home technology, has introduced its latest innovations at CES 2026. The company unveiled the AI-powered LiDAX Ultra series of robotic lawn mowers and the MOVA Rover X10 robotic pool cleaner, setting new benchmarks for intelligent outdoor living solutions. These advanced devices leverage cutting-edge technology to enhance functionality and environmental adaptability.

Advanced Features of the LiDAX Ultra Series

The LiDAX Ultra series consists of two models: the LiDAX Ultra 1000 and the LiDAX Ultra 2000. Both models boast intelligent navigation capabilities, powered by UltraView 2.0 Environment Sensing technology. This innovative system combines 360-degree high-precision LiDAR with an AI-enhanced 1080p HDR camera, enabling faster real-time mapping and effective obstacle avoidance.

The robotic mowers are designed to operate seamlessly in complex environments, including challenging lighting conditions and nighttime operations. Key features include AI-assisted auto-mapping and advanced obstacle detection, ensuring that the mowers can navigate around various obstacles without difficulty. The UltraTrim 1.0 system provides high-precision edge trimming, eliminating gaps when approaching walls and hedges. Users can manage mowing preferences through the companion MOVA app, including adjusting cutting heights and setting over 150 mowing zones.

Introducing the MOVA Rover X10 Robotic Pool Cleaner

MOVA also highlighted the Rover X10, which is touted as the industry’s first 7-in-1 pool cleaning solution. This robotic cleaner integrates LiDAR technology for comprehensive pool maintenance. Its underwater Laser Distance Sensor and 360-degree AquaScan system facilitate thorough scanning, while AI-powered precision control ensures full pool coverage.

The Rover X10 features advanced jet-drive motors powered by FloatDrive technology, providing exceptional maneuverability and suction power. The PoolNavi path-planning system optimizes cleaning routes by utilizing underwater sensor fusion and AI to detect obstacles. Users can take advantage of the MOVA app for remote spot cleaning, mode switching, and access to detailed cleaning logs.

Pricing and Availability

The LiDAX Ultra series will be available from January 29, 2026, with the LiDAX Ultra 1000 priced at $1,299 and the LiDAX Ultra 2000 at $1,799. The Rover X10 robotic pool cleaner will follow on March 26, 2026, retailing for $2,799.
